  • A wonderful sequel to an amazing mobile game

    SodaDungeon2 is a very good sequel to the original. I like the new content that was added and I think it improves the quality of the game. I think the gameplay of this series does get a little repetitive with it just having simple turn based RPG mechanics. But the captivating gameplay loop always proving interesting loot to collect to improve your adventurers and make your dungeon attempts more efficient makes it enjoyable. All of this coupled with an amazing soundtrack makes this a wonderful time waster and a worthy sequel to the original.

  • A Light For Mobile Games

    This game is a God send and we all needed a great mobile game that treats the players correctly and this game nailed it! I’ve always been a fan of rouge-like RPG’s and this has to be one of my top favorites. The grinding in this game isn’t that tedious when it comes to grinding, but there is a reason why I’m giving it 4/5 stars. The end game after dimension 10 isn’t perfect. What I mean is, grinding for the legendary gear doesn’t feel all that much powerful from the rare gear. It pretty much doubles the damage but there’s nothing much else that’s special that makes it legendary. Also if it does t have a gem socket, it’s pretty much useless to me, in my opinion. Other than this minor inconvenience, this game is more than a great game.
